Tooth starts rotting when diets containing (sugars and starches, for example, breads, grains, milk, pop, natural products, cakes, or sweet are left on the teeth. Microorganisms that live in the mouth happily consume these food stuck between our teeth, transforming them into acids. The bacteria, sustenance flotsam and jetsam, and saliva join to structure plaque, which sticks to the teeth. The acids in plaque disintegrate the lacquer surface of the teeth, making gaps in the teeth called cavity.




Simple steps to prevent cavity:

  • Brush your teeth in any event twice a day with fluoride-containing toothpaste. Ideally, brush after every feast and particularly before going to sleep.
  • Clean between your teeth every day with dental floss or interdental cleaners.
  • Eat healthy and balance diet. Dodge carbs, for example, sweet, pretzels and chips, which can stay on the tooth surface. In case, sticky foods are consumed, brush your teeth soon subsequently.
  • Check with your dental specialist about utilization of supplemental fluoride, which fortifies your teeth.
  • Ask your doc about dental sealants (a plastic defensive covering) connected to the biting surfaces of your back teeth (molars) to shield them from rot.
  • Drink no less than a half quart of fluoridated water every day is expected to shield youngsters from cavity.
  • Get appointment at regularly interval with your dentist for expert cleanings and oral test.

Scholars and researchers are growing new intends to beat tooth deterioration. One study found that a chewing gum that contains the sweetener xylitol briefly hindered the development of microorganisms that cause tooth rot. Likewise, a few materials that gradually discharge fluoride over the long haul, which will help avoid further rot, are being investigated. These materials would be set between teeth or in pits and gaps of teeth. Toothpastes and mouth flushes that can turn around and "mend" early depressions are likewise being examined.
